#f78f22 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f78f22 is composed of 96.9% red, 56.1%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 30.7 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 55.1%. #f78f22 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#ef1f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#f78f22

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060300 is the darkest color, while #fff9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f78f22

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d8c is the less saturated color, while #f78f22 is the most saturated one.
